-/*
- * strnstr - locate a substring in a fixed-size string.
- *
- * PARAMETERS:
- * _CONST char *haystack - the string in which to search.
- * _CONST char *needle - the string which to search.
- * int length - the maximum 'haystack' string length.
- *
- * DESCRIPTION:
- * The strstr() function finds the first occurrence of the substring
- * 'needle'in the string 'haystack'. At most 'length' bytes is searched.
- *
- * RETURN:
- * Returns a pointer to the beginning of the substring, or NULL if the
- * substring was not found.
- */
-static char *
-_DEFUN(strnstr, (haystack, needle, length),
- _CONST char *haystack _AND
- _CONST char *needle _AND
- int length)
-{
- int i;
- _CONST char *max = haystack + length;
-
- if (*haystack == '\0')
- return *needle == '\0' ? (char *)haystack : NULL;
-
- while (haystack < max)
- {
- i = 0;
- while (1)
- {
- if (needle[i] == '\0')
- return (char *)haystack;
- if (needle[i] != haystack[i++])
- break;
- }
- haystack += 1;
- }
- return (char *)NULL;
-}

-/*
- * canonical_form - canonize 'str'.
- *
- * PARAMETERS:
- * struct _reent *rptr - reent structure of curent thread/process.
- * _CONST char *str - string to canonize.
- *
- * DESCRIPTION:
- * Converts all letters to small and substitute all '-' by '_'.
- *
- * RETURN:
- * Returns canonical form of 'str' if success, NULL if failure.
- */
-static _CONST char *
-_DEFUN(canonical_form, (rptr, str),
- struct _reent *rptr _AND
- _CONST char *str)
-{
- char *p, *p1;
-
- if (str == NULL || (p = p1 = _strdup_r(rptr, str)) == NULL)
- return NULL;
-
- for (; *str; str++, p++)
- {
- if (*str == '-')
- *p = '_';
- else
- *p = tolower(*str);
- }
-
- return (_CONST char *)p1;
-}

-/*
- * find_alias - find "official" name by alias.
- *
- * PARAMETERS:
- * struct _reent *rptr - reent structure of curent thread/process.
- * _CONST char *alias - alias by which "official" name should be found.
- * _CONST char *table - aliases table.
- * int len - aliases table length.
- *
- * DESCRIPTION:
- * 'table' contains the list of names and their aliases. "Official"
- * names go first, e.g.:
- *
- * Official_name1 alias11 alias12 alias1N
- * Official_name2 alias21 alias22 alias2N
- * Official_nameM aliasM1 aliasM2 aliasMN
- *
- * If line begins with backspace it is considered as the continuation of
- * previous line.
- *
- * RETURN:
- * Returns pointer to "official" name if success, NULL if failure.
- */
-static _CONST char *
-_DEFUN(find_alias, (rptr, alias, table, len),
- struct _reent *rptr _AND
- _CONST char *alias _AND
- _CONST char *table _AND
- int len)
-{
- _CONST char *end;
- _CONST char *p;
- _CONST char *candidate;
- int l = strlen(alias);
- _CONST char *ptable = table;
- _CONST char *table_end = table + len;
-
- if (table == NULL || alias == NULL || *table == '\0' || *alias == '\0')
- return NULL;
-
-search_again:
- if (len < l)
- return NULL;
-
- if ((p = strnstr(ptable, alias, len)) == NULL)
- return NULL;
-
- /* Check that substring is segregated by '\n', '\t' or ' ' */
- if (!((p == table || *(p-1) == ' ' || *(p-1) == '\n' || *(p-1) == '\t') &&
- (p+l == table_end || *(p+l) == ' ' || *(p+l) == '\n' || *(p+l) == '\t')))
- {
- ptable = p + l;
- len -= table - p;
- goto search_again;
- }
-
- while(!(--p < table || (*p == '\n' && *(p+1) != ' ' && *(p+1) != '\t')));
-
- if (*(++p) == '#')
- return NULL;
-
- for (end = p + 1; *end != '\t' && *end != ' ' && *end != '\n' && *end != '\0'; end++);
-
- return _strndup_r(rptr, p, (size_t)(end - p));
-}
